Great toe Bone dislocated.
Great toe Bone was dislocated.surgery done (k wire insertion) Now wire removed and stitches dried/cut. Unable to bend toe & hence problem in walking. Recommended physiotherapy by Dr Gaurav (Apollo spectra)

Yes physiotherapy shall help you. Use hot and cold treatment alternatively. Also you can use wax therapy if the stictches have dried up and healed well. Do range of motion exercises and also for home exercise you can curl a towel with your toes on the towel
